AVC_FUNCTION_GET_SUBUNIT_INFO

AVC_FUNCTION_GET_SUBUNIT_INFO函数代码获取目标设备的子单元信息。

I/O 状态块

此函数始终将 Irp-IoStatus.Status> 设置为 STATUS_SUCCESS。

注释

此函数使用 AVC_MULTIFUNC_IRB 结构的 Subunits 成员,如下所示。

typedef struct _AVC_MULTIFUNC_IRB {
  AVC_IRB  Common;
  union {
    .
    .
    .
    AVC_SUBUNIT_INFO_BLOCK Subunits;
 };
} AVC_MULTIFUNC_IRB, *PAVC_MULTIFUNC_IRB;

要求

头:avc.h 中声明。 包括 avc.h

AVC_MULTIFUNC_IRB输入

通用
此成员的 Function 子成员必须设置为 从AVC_FUNCTION 枚举AVC_FUNCTION_GET_SUBUNIT_INFO。

亚基
指定 AV/C 子单元信息的说明。

在本地满足此函数,因此不会向目标发送任何命令。

可以在 IRQL <= DISPATCH_LEVEL 调用此函数代码。

另请参阅

AVC_MULTIFUNC_IRB

AVC_SUBUNIT_INFO_BLOCK

AVC_FUNCTION